Political factors

Icon

Regulatory Environment Stability

Aris Water's operations are heavily influenced by political factors, especially in the Permian Basin, where water management regulations are crucial. The stability of regulatory bodies like the Texas Railroad Commission and EPA directly affects permitting and compliance. For example, the Texas Railroad Commission's new rules on oil and gas waste, effective July 1, 2025, show this ongoing evolution. These changes impact Aris Water's operations.

Oil and Gas Waste Management Regulations

The Texas Railroad Commission (TRC) sets rules for oil and gas waste, including produced water. New 2025 regulations impact waste pits, recycling, and transport. Compliance is essential to avoid penalties. In 2024, the TRC issued 1,200+ violation notices related to waste management. Companies face fines up to $10,000 daily for non-compliance.

Contractual Obligations and Agreements

Aris Water's operations heavily rely on legally binding contracts, primarily with energy companies. These agreements, crucial for water handling and recycling, are the foundation of its business model. The enforceability and specifics of these contracts, including acreage commitments, greatly impact revenue stability and operational requirements. A significant portion of Aris Water's projected volumes is secured through these long-term contracts, as reported in Q1 2024 filings.

Reducing Trucking and Associated Emissions

Aris Water's pipeline infrastructure dramatically cuts trucking needs for produced water, thereby diminishing emissions, traffic, and road damage. This shift significantly lowers the environmental footprint of water transportation, a core advantage of their model. The trucking industry accounts for a substantial portion of transportation emissions. This strategy aligns with growing environmental regulations and investor preferences for sustainable practices.

  • Trucks account for approximately 23% of all transportation-related greenhouse gas emissions in the United States as of 2024.
  • Pipeline transport can reduce emissions by up to 80% compared to trucking, according to recent industry studies.

Ecological Impact of Disposal and Recycling

Aris Water's disposal and recycling methods significantly affect the environment. Injection wells, used for produced water disposal, can lead to groundwater contamination and trigger earthquakes. Recycling reduces disposal volumes, but requires careful treatment to avoid environmental harm. In 2024, the EPA reported over 30,000 injection wells used for disposal. Proper management and treatment are crucial for ecological protection.
